From: Jeff Cody Date: Mon, 28 Apr 2014 18:37:18 +0000 (-0400) Subject: block: Add '--version' option to qemu-img X-Git-Tag: TizenStudio_2.0_p2.3.2~208^2~872^2~28 X-Git-Url: http://review.tizen.org/git/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=5f6979cba9f63480d38e9deb72b565c6781ac0e8;p=sdk%2Femulator%2Fqemu.git block: Add '--version' option to qemu-img This allows qemu-img to print out version information, without needing to print the long help wall of text. While there, perform some minor whitespace cleanup, and remove the unused option_index variable in the call to getopt_long().
